Getting to participate in the 3-week immersive fieldwork course in South Africa has proven to be one of the most incredible experiences, and in more ways than I could have imagined. Our group was based in Kruger National Park at the Skukuza Science Leadership Initiative (SSLI) Campus, surrounded by both the amazing staff and the savanna we came to study. Our purpose was to gain hands-on experience in ecological fieldwork while considering how human presence affects and is affected by the surrounding environment and its changes. We got to participate in ongoing research efforts within Kruger and in the towns outside the park. More specifically, the fieldwork was centered around investigating how land-use change impacts mammal composition, parasites/vectors composition and presence, and vegetation structure. The methods we used included: live traps for rodents, combing the rodents for ectoparasites, transects for vegetation data, and use of camera trap data for further analysis.
Field days started before sunrise and were often chilly, but these early mornings were designed to take advantage of checking on the rodent traps before the heat got too intense. Most days we set out to check traps, and if we found an unmarked rodent, we collected data on species, weight, length (body, tail, hind foot), sex, age, and combed for parasites. Depending on need, we also took blood spots and fecal samples. Having never worked with small mammals before, it was fun to see how the different native species varied in their physical and behavioral characteristics. Vegetation data was collected over 1-2 days at each site while checking rodent traps. We set up two 50-meter transects at each of our sites, one running N-S and one E-W, taking measurements every 5 meters on things such as ground cover and canopy height/density.
Working in teams, our cohort got to present our findings on our research, where, after a few weeks of learning about savannah ecology and being out in the field, we got to see the patterns emerge in our data and see how interconnected the topics we presented on truly were. Learning, collecting data, and presenting research while tying in a “one health” perspective was fascinating and a great way to see real applications of conservation science I’d typically only hear about within the walls of a lecture hall.
